15-5PH钢奥氏体晶粒长大行为研究  

Study on Austenite Grain Growth Behavior of 15-5PH Steel

摘  要:研究了15-5PH沉淀硬化马氏体不锈钢在(900~1 250)℃加热温度区间和(0.5~15)h保温时间范围内奥氏体晶粒的长大行为。结果表明,随着加热温度的升高和保温时间的延长,15-5PH钢奥氏体晶粒尺寸长大。实验保温时间内,1 100℃以下奥氏体晶粒尺寸缓慢长大,1 100℃以上奥氏体晶粒尺寸迅速粗化;实验温度区间内,1 050℃以下加热奥氏体晶粒尺寸基本稳定,随着保温时间的延长长大倾向很小;1 050℃以上加热奥氏体晶粒尺寸在1 h内迅速长大,然后随着保温时间进一步延长,而缓慢长大。建立了15-5PH钢加热的奥氏体晶粒长大的Beck修正模型和Sellars模型。The growth behavior of austenite grains in 15-5PH precipitation-hardened martensitic stainless steel has been studied in the range of(900~1250)℃and(0.5~15)h.The results show that the austenite grain size of 15-5PH steel increases with increasing heating temperature and holding time.Under 1100℃,the austenite grain size grows slowly,and above 1100℃,the austenite grain size coarsenes rapidly.In the experimental temperature range,the austenite grain size is basically stable under 1050℃,and the tendency to grow is small with the extension of holding time.The austenite grain size grows rapidly within 1 hour when heated above 1050℃,and then grows slowly with the further extension of holding time.The Beck modified model and Sellars model of austenite grain growth in 15-5PH steel were established.
